Company Description

Wonderful Education provides the resources that every student needs to succeed in school and launch a rewarding career. With two preschools and innovative Career Pathways and College Success programs, we are reinventing the educational experience for students across California’s Central Valley. Between these programs and our new Wonderful Career Center, we are working to break the cycle of generational poverty and increase long-term career opportunities. Lynda and Stewart Resnick, co-owners of The Wonderful Company, along with their foundation, fund college scholarships. The Resnicks also founded two K–12 Wonderful College Prep Academy charter schools in Delano and Lost Hills, California, and continue to support them to this day. Job Description

We are seeking a College Success Coach to serve as an advisor and counselor for a caseload of scholars at every step of their educational journey, beginning in the spring of 12th grade through college completion and career planning. The ideal candidate brings a passion for and experience in education or youth development, a tireless commitment to helping scholars overcome barriers, and the ability to contribute to a fast-paced team that works across the state. The College Success team is currently hiring a Coach to support scholars attending Cal Poly San Luis Obispo, with a smaller additional caseload at CSU Bakersfield. This role will require daily in-person support at Cal Poly SLO, with in-person visits to CSU Bakersfield once a week or biweekly, depending on need. Occasional evening and weekend hours may also be required.

Provide a holistic approach to support students in meeting their goals by creating individualized action plans for each scholar around their career, well-being, finances, and academics near the beginning of each academic year, updating throughout the year, as needed.

Essential Job Duties & Responsibilities:

  • Provide follow-through when executing each scholar's individualized plan, holding scholars accountable, and providing encouragement, activities, and guidance.
  • Utilize our suite of resources to support scholars from tutoring, health and wellness referrals, internships, career/graduate school planning, etc.
  • Review midterm scholar progress reports and adjust the scholar’s action plan, as needed.
  • Support scholars through the scholarship renewal process: reviewing transcripts and upcoming term course schedules, updating graduation projections, etc. ensuring programmatic data is clear and accurate.
  • Collaborate with fellow Coaches and Wonderful College Ambassadors to provide added support.
  • Participate in team workgroups, focused on various topics.
  • Occasionally lead and support school- or virtually-based workshops
  • Begin supporting rising college freshmen beginning in early summer - including overnight summer camps - and on-campus kickoff events.
  • Ability and willingness to tutor, where possible.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ree required in a related field. A STEM degree is a plus.
  • A commitment and passion for educational equity and justice and the desire to work tirelessly for students from California's Central Valley.
  • An eager, flexible learner and problem solver who feels comfortable taking initiative and going the extra mile for students.
  • A self-starter with an exceptional work ethic and the ability to work well away from colleagues and management.
  • Outstanding written and verbal communication skills.
  • An ability to quickly establish rapport and communicate well with scholars.
  • A valid California driver's license is required.
  • Bilingual in Spanish is a plus.
  • Familiarity with case management methodology
  • Understanding of college success strategies, particularly for first-generation students
  • Strong understanding of studying techniques
  • Tutoring capability in some subjects, especially STEM, a plus
